- A Hoschton man and a Gainesville woman were arrested Tuesday during a multi-agency drug bust in Buford, where authorities found more than $41,000 worth of drugs, a handgun and thousands in cash.

Jason Lee Watson, 40, and Meagan Victoria Feaster, 26, each face 16 charges, including trafficking heroin, possession of heroin with the intent to distribute, trafficking methamphetamine, possession of methamphetamine with the intent to distribute, possession with the intent to distribute of the following; LSD, MDMA, Hydrocodone, Oxycodone, Alprazolam, Suboxone, Clonazepam, Methadone, Amphetamine, Phentermine; possession of marijuana and possession of a firearm during the commission of a felony, according to Hall County MANS Lt. Don Scalia.

On July 11, police say officers arrested Watson and Feaster at their camper on Lake Lanier Islands after a joint investigation by the Hall County and the Georgia National Guard task force teams. During the bust, officers seized a number of drugs listed in the above charges, with a street value of $41,800, along with drug paraphernalia and $5,600.

Authorities believe the two had been at the site for no longer than a week.
